[dpdk-dev,19/41] eal: add API to check if memory is contiguous
Checks
Commit Message
This will be helpful down the line when we implement support for
allocating physically contiguous memory. We can no longer guarantee
physically contiguous memory unless we're in IOVA_AS_VA mode, but
we can certainly try and see if we succeed. In addition, this would
be useful for e.g. PMD's who may allocate chunks that are smaller
than the pagesize, but they must not cross the page boundary, in
which case we will be able to accommodate that request.
Signed-off-by: Anatoly Burakov <anatoly.burakov@intel.com>

+bool
+eal_memalloc_is_contig(struct rte_memseg_list *msl, void *start,
+ size_t len)
+{
+ const struct rte_memseg *ms;
+ uint64_t page_sz;
+ void *end;
+ int start_page, end_page, cur_page;
+ rte_iova_t expected;
+
+ /* for legacy memory, it's always contiguous */
+ if (internal_config.legacy_mem)
+ return true;
+
+ /* figure out how many pages we need to fit in current data */
+ page_sz = msl->hugepage_sz;
+ end = RTE_PTR_ADD(start, len);
+
+ start_page = RTE_PTR_DIFF(start, msl->base_va) / page_sz;
+ end_page = RTE_PTR_DIFF(end, msl->base_va) / page_sz;
+
+ /* now, look for contiguous memory */
+ ms = rte_fbarray_get(&msl->memseg_arr, start_page);
+ expected = ms->iova + page_sz;
+
+ for (cur_page = start_page + 1; cur_page < end_page;
+ cur_page++, expected += page_sz) {
+ ms = rte_fbarray_get(&msl->memseg_arr, cur_page);
+
+ if (ms->iova != expected)
+ return false;
+ }
+
+ return true;
+}
